7.6.20.12.36. Weld

Syntax

Viscosity [{of} SpeciesName] = Weld [Interpolated = interpolated | Beta = beta | C0 = c0 | C1 = c1 | C2 = c2 | C3 = c3 | T_Liq = T_liq | T_90 = t_90 | T_Max = T_max]

Scope

Aria Material

Summary

This is an empirical model that emulates the melting of a solid metal during the laser welding process.

\mu\left(T\right)=
\begin{cases}\mu_{90} + \left(\mu_{liq} - \mu_{90} \right) \left(\dfrac{T - T_{90}}{T_{liq} - T_{90}}\right) & T < T_{liq} \\c_0 + c_1 \hat{T} + c_2 \hat{T}^2 + c_3 \hat{T}^3 & T \geq T_{liq} ,\end{cases}

where \mu_{liq} is given by

\mu_{liq} = c_0 + c_1 T_{liq} + c_2  T_{liq}^2 + c_3 T_{liq}^3 ,

and where \mu_{90} = \beta\mu_{liq} and \hat{T} = \min(T,T_{max}). The default value of \beta is 10^{11}.
